Now that we know what inanesynonyms are, it's essential to understand the *potential* pitfalls of using them incorrectly. Using the wrong word can lead to misunderstandings, confusion, and even a complete breakdown in communication. Imagine trying to describe your favorite food as "terrible" when you actually meant "delicious." The audience would be super confused! This isn't just a minor issue; it strikes at the heart of our ability to connect, persuade, and share ideas. If you use the wrong word, you can make your writing seem either unclear or just plain awkward. So, how can you avoid these linguistic landmines? First, be mindful of the context. What are you trying to say, and who are you saying it to? The same word can have different meanings in different contexts. Second, pay attention to the connotations of words. Are there emotions or ideas that are associated with the words you are using? For example, the words "thrifty" and "cheap" both relate to money saving, however, "thrifty" carries a positive connotation of resourcefulness while "cheap" can be seen as negative, describing someone who's unwilling to spend money. Third, embrace the thesaurus – but use it with caution! A thesaurus is an excellent tool for finding alternatives, but make sure you understand the subtle differences between the words before you use them. Do not rely solely on the thesaurus.
